  • Patent number: 4173279
    Abstract: A fluid metering and transfer system is disclosed in which, in a preferred embodiment, a fluid contained in a reservoir is transferred in small amounts by a dipper wire to a conduit extending through the bottom of the reservoir. The fluid is then distributed by gravity flow through the tube to the desired location. The dipper wire is rigidly mounted onto a pivotable shaft. When the present invention is used for transferring lubricating liquid to machines, the shaft of the present invention can be coupled to a shaft of the machine so that the present invention only transfers and distributes the lubricating liquid when the machine is operating.

  • Patent number: 4110859
    Abstract: There is disclosed a passenger loading ramp for transfer of passengers between a terminal and an airplane parked in a parking station adjacent thereto. Adjacent the terminal is a swing support post including means for accommodating swinging about a vertical axis. A rigid passenger walkway is carried on one end from such swing post by means of a horizontally extending pivot and projects to the parking station. An elevating post is disposed intermediate the swing post and parking station for adjusting the elevation of the free extremity of the walkway and includes a gear rack arrangement for swinging the walkway laterally relative thereto. A cab is suspended from the free extremity of the walkway by means of a parallelogrammatic linkage which is coupled with the swing post and operative to maintain the cab floor level irrespective of the elevation of the free extremity of such walkway.

  • Patent number: 4068965
    Abstract: A single piece coupling for shafts comprises opposite half sections each with an arcuate recess for engaging one side of two axially aligned shafts. There are also spaces forming a keyway for reception of a conventional key with which the shafts are provided. The half sections are initially formed in a spread apart condition with captive edges secured to each other by a section of the coupling metal forming thereby a hinge. After adjacent ends of the shafts are slid into the coupling to abutting positions free edges of the half sections are bolted together drawing the half sections simultaneously into engagement with the shafts and the key.

  • Patent number: 4015696
    Abstract: A centrifugal braking device of compact design uses at least one centrifugal body pivotally connected to a sprocket to shift from a rest position to a stop position to brake movement of a rotary shaft under certain conditions. Thus, depending upon the rotary speed and/or acceleration of the rotary shaft, the centrifugal body will pivotally shift from a rest position to a stop position to prevent rotation of the shaft. A substantially stationary annular member disposed concentrically around the hub of the sprocket has an inner bore which defines a stop for the centrifugal body when said body is shifted outwardly. Said outer bore also defines a cam surface to aid displacement of the centrifugal body from the stop position to the rest position when the shaft is rotated in a specified direction.
